Ingredients
- 24 fresh strawberries
- 1 cup white candy melts or white chocolate melting wafers
- 1/2 cup red, white, and blue nonpareil sprinkles
Instructions
- Rinse strawberries gently under cool water and pat dry completely with paper towels.
- In a small deep bowl, melt white candy melts in the microwave in 30-second increments until smooth.
- Dip each strawberry into the melted chocolate (about 2/3 covered) and then roll in sprinkles.
- Place on a baking sheet lined with wax or parchment paper and allow to set until chocolate hardens.
- Serve immediately for the best flavor.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
